Study: Software(SW)/SW: Etc...
[IDE] VSCode 파일 확장자 인식 설정 방법
💡 본 문서는 'VSCode 파일 확장자 인식 설정 방법'에 대해 정리해놓은 글입니다. simulation 코딩을 하다보면 .world 파일 같은 확장자를 가진 파일이 xml 인식이 안되는 경우가 있습니다. 이런 경우는 다 같은 색으로 보여 보기 불편하므로 VS code 상에서 설정하는 방법에 대해 정리하였으니 참고하시기 바랍니다.VSCode 파일 확장자 인식 설정 방법visual studio code에서 좌측 하단에 있는 설정 모양을 클릭(단축키 : ctrl+,)setting 창이 켜지면 "file association"이라고 검색Files: Associations 에 "Add Item"을 눌러 Item과 Value를 페어로 넣기참고[blog] [Visual Studio Code] 파일 확장자 인식 설..
[SW] IT 시스템에서 시간의 표현: '윤초'와 그 미래
💡 본 문서는 'IT 시스템에서 시간의 표현: 윤초'에 대해 정리해놓은 글입니다. 프로그래밍을 하지 않더라도 윤초는 많이 들어봤을 개념입니다. 이는 정해져있는 것이 아닌 지구 자전속도 때문에 발생하는 불규칙적인 보정인데 이로 인해 UTC와 동기화되는 레거시 장비 등 보정으로 인한 득보다 실이 많은 위험한 관행입니다. 이러한 윤초에 대해 상세히 정리하였으니 참고하시기 바랍니다. 1. 윤초(Leap Second)란? 윤초는 지구 자전속도 때문에 생기는 UT1(세계시) 과 UTC의 차이를 보정하기 위해 도입됨 이는 UTC를 천체 관측 등 다양한 목적으로 사용할 수 있게 해주기 때문에 과학자와 천문학자에게 주로 도움이 됨 UTC를 수정하지 않으면 천문 관측을 위해 UTC와 동기화 되는 레거시 장비 및 소프트웨어..
[문서] 한글 서식 단축키 정리
💡 본 문서는 '한글 서식 단축키'에 대해 정리해놓은 글입니다. 한국(?)의 특성상 교수님, 공공기관에서 '한글'을 사용하기에, 어쩔 수 없이 사용하게 되는 경우가 종종 있습니다. 이때 약간의 단축키를 알고 있으면 업무 효율이 극대화되기에 가장 잘 사용되고 있는 단축키를 정리해놓은 글 입니다. (참고로 한글의 단축키를 모두 정리해놓은 파일을 첨부해놓았으니 업무에 참고 바랍니다.) 가장 유용하게 사용되는 한글 단축키 정리 기능 단축키 편집용지 창 띄우기 F7 문서 저장 CTRL + S 글꼴 설정 ALT + L 서식을 설정하여 업무 효율성 올리는 단축키 정리 서식을 지정해두고 해당 서식을 지정한 텍스트의 경우, 글꼴의 모양 등을 일괄적으로 바꾸기 쉽습니다. 하지만, 특정 서식을 지정하면 해당 서식에서의 문단..
[SW] IT 시스템에서 시간의 표현: epoch time, Unix/POSIX time, time stamp...
💡 본 문서는 'IT 시스템에서 시간의 표현'에 대해 정리해놓은 글입니다. 프로그래밍을 하다보면 epoch time, Unix/POSIX time, time stamp와 같이 다양한 시간 관련 용어를 접하게 됩니다. 이를 구분하고 사용하는 상황과 용례를 정리하였으니 참고하시기 바랍니다. 1. IT 시스템에서 시간의 표현 대부분의 프로그래밍 언어와 데이터베이스에는 현재 시간을 나타내는 함수가 있습니다. 이 시간 정보는 물리적인 장비의 내부 타이머 혹은 인터넷을 통한 GMT 시간 수신 등의 방법을 사용합니다. Windows 운영 체제와 같은 소프트웨어에서는 내부 타이머의 변경이 가능하지만, 임베디드 장비에 포함된 클럭에서는 생산 시점에 고정된 값을 변경하지 못할 수도 있습니다. 이토록 사람이 이해할 수 있..
[JAVA] Oracle JAVA 삭제 후 Apache Open JDK 설치
0. 왜 Open JDK? 2018년 오라클의 라이선스 체계가 변경되면서 2019년 1월 이후 더 이상 무료로 Oracle JDK를 사용할 수 없게 되었음. 이에 많은 곳에서 OpenJDK를 적용하는 방안을 검토하고 있음. 1. Uninstall JAVA $ sudo rm -fr /Library/Internet\ Plug-Ins/JavaAppletPlugin.plugin $ sudo rm -fr /Library/PreferencePanes/JavaControlPanel.prefPane $ sudo rm -fr ~/Library/Application\ Support/Oracle/Java $ rm -r ~/"Library/Application Support/Oracle/Java" 2. Install JAVA..